Credit (finance) - Credit as a financial term, used in such terms as credit card, refers to the granting of a loan and the creation of debt. Any movement of financial capital is normally quite dependent on credit, which in turn is dependent on the reputation or creditworthiness of the entity which takes responsibility for the funds. Credit default option - In finance, a default option or credit default option is an option to buy protection (payer option) or sell protection (receiver option) as a credit default swap on a specific reference credit with a specific maturity. The option is usually european, excercisable only at one date in the future at a specific strike price defined as a coupon on the credit default swap. Secretary of Finance (Mexico) - In Mexico The Secretary of Finance is the head of the Secretariat of Finance and Public Credit (SecretarÃa de Hacienda y Crédito Público or SHCP). This position is analogous to the Secretary of the Treasury in the United States of America or to the Finance ministers in other nations.
